July 3 - YANKEE DOODLE DANDY (1942)
Ring up the curtain for a red, white, and blue tribute to actor-playwright-composer-dancer George M. Cohan! Warners’ Ace, Michael Curtiz helms an all-star cast, led by James Cagney in his favorite (and Oscar-winning) role. Cohan set the heartbeat of America to music, and Cagney brings all the showmanship in a once-in-a-lifetime role! Showstoppers abound: Yankee Doodle Boy, Grand Old Flag, Give My Regards to Broadway, and Over There.
